  1. Has Google Won the Smart Display Race? Home Hub

  2. What's New with Google? At its hardware event, Google recently introduced a number of new devices. Aside from a new Chrome OS tablet and the anticipated Pixel 3 and 3XL handsets, a new smart display called the Home Hub joins the original Home, Home Max, and Home Mini. It was only the announcement, and Google's already ahead of the race. Aside from having the Google brand in its favour, with a price tag of only USD 149, Home Hub is about USD 80 cheaper than its competitors like Echo Show and Facebook Portal. Additionally, it can also show Youtube videos, which Show is incapable of.

  3. On both price and functionality, Google Home Hub is expected to sell fairly better than all other smart displays. The most viable option for third parties making smart displays will be to target specific market segments or focus on enhancing features; if they hope to contend with Home Hub.

  4. Why It Matters to Marketers Sales of smart speakers have already reached more than 50 million, yet it so far remains not to fare well as a marketing tool. With the introduction of screen features, however, an expanded user experience anticipates more opportunities for branding and commerce. If subsequently, smart displays receive a universal acceptance in households, then these devices could become an essential channel for the marketing field.
